Deye 8kW Single Phase Hybrid Solar Inverters SUN-8K-SG05LP1-EU-SM2-P
products formPRODUCTS
| Model | SUN-7K-SG05LP1-EU-SM2 | SUN-7.6K-SG05LP1-EU | SUN-8K-SG05LP1-EU-SM2 | SUN-10K-SG05LP1-EU-SM2 |
| Battery Input Data | ||||
| Battery Type | Lead-acid or Lithium-ion | |||
| Battery Voltage Range(V) | 40-60 | |||
| Max.Charging Current(A) | 175 | 190 | 190 | 210 |
| Max.Discharging Current(A) | 175 | 190 | 190 | 210 |
| Charging Strategy for Li-ion Battery | Self-adaption to BMS | |||
| Number of battery input | 1 | |||
| PV String Input Data | ||||
| Max. PV Access Power (W) | 14000 | 15200 | 16000 | 20000 |
| Max PV Input Power(W) | 11200 | 12160 | 12800 | 16000 |
| Max PV Input Voltage(V) | 500 | |||
| Start-up Voltage(V) | 125 | |||
| MPPT Voltage Range(V) | 150-425 | |||
| Rated PV Input Voltage(V) | 370 | |||
| Max Operating PV Input Current(A) | 26+26 | |||
| Max Input Short-Circuit Current(A) | 34+34 | |||
| No.of MPP Trackers/No.of String Per MPP Tracker | 2/2+2 | |||
| AC Input/Output Data | ||||
| Rated AC Input/Output Active Power(W) | 7000 | 7600 | 8000 | 10000 |
| Max AC Input/Output Apparent Power (VA) | 7700 | 8360 | 8800 | 11000 |
| Rated AC Input/Output Current(A) | 31.9/30.5 | 34.5/33.1 | 36.4/34.8 | 45.5/43.5 |
| Max AC Input/Output Current(A) | 35/33.5 | 38/36.4 | 40/38.3 | 50/47.9 |
| Max Continuous AC Passthrough (grid to load)(A) | 50 | |||
| Peak Power (off-grid)(W) | 2 times of rated power,10s | |||
| Rated Input/Output Voltage/Range(V) | 220V/230 0.85Un-1.1Un | |||
| Grid Connection Form | L+N+PE | |||
| Rated Input/Output Grid Frequency/Range | 50Hz/45Hz-55Hz 60Hz/55Hz-65Hz | |||
| Power Factor Adjustment Range | 0.8 leading-0.8lagging | |||
| Total Current Harmonic Distortion THDi | <3% (of nominal power) | |||
| DC Injection Current | <0.5%ln | |||
| Efficiency | ||||
| Max Efficiency | 97.60% | |||
| Euro Efficiency | 96.50% | |||
| MPPT Efficiency | >99% | |||
| Equipment Protection | ||||
| Integrated | DC Reverse Polarity Protection, AC Output Overcurrent Protection, Thermal Protection, AC Output Overvoltage Protection, AC Output Short Circuit Protection, DC Component Monitoring, Arc Fault Circuit Interrupter (optional), Anti-islanding Protection, DC Switch, Insulation Impedance Detection, Residual Current Detection | |||
| Surge Protection Level | TYPE II(DC),TYPE II(AC) | |||
| Interface | ||||
| Communication Interface | RS485/RS232/CAN | |||
| Monitor Mode | GPRS/WIFI/Bluetooth/4G/LAN(optional) | |||
| General Data | ||||
| Operating Temperature Range | -40 to +60℃, >45℃ Derating | |||
| Permissible Ambient Humidity | 0~100% | |||
| Permissible Altitude | 2000m | |||
| Noise | <45 | |||
| Ingress Protection(IP) Rating | IP 65 | |||
| Inverter Topology | Non-Isolated | |||
| Over Voltage Category | OVC II(DC),OVC III(AC) | |||
| Cabinet size(W*H*D)[mm] | 366×589.5×237 (Excluding Connectors and Brackets) | |||
| Weight[kg] | 26.8 | |||
| Warranty | 5 Years/10 Years | |||
| the Warranty Period Depends the Final Installation Site of Inverter, More Info Please Refer to Warranty Policy | ||||
| Type Of Cooling | Intelligent air cooling | |||
| Grid Regulation | IEC 61727,IEC 62116,CEI 0-21,EN 50549,NRS 097,RD 140,UNE 217002,OVE-Richtlinie R25,G99,VDE-AR-N 4105 | |||
| Safety EMC/Standard | IEC/EN 61000-6-1/2/3/4, IEC/EN 62109-1, IEC/EN 62109-2 | |||

❓ FAQ
1. Is this inverter suitable for a full home power system?
Yes. 8kW is ideal for medium to large households and can support most daily appliances simultaneously.
2. What battery types are compatible?
Supports 48V lithium-ion and lead-acid batteries, offering flexibility in system design.
3. Can I expand the system later?
Yes. You can parallel up to 16 units, making it scalable for future load increases.
4. Does it work during power outages?
Yes. It automatically switches to battery mode, ensuring continuous power supply (UPS function).
5. Can I add this to an existing solar system?
Yes. AC coupling allows easy integration with existing grid-tied systems without replacing current inverters.
6. Is it suitable for areas with unstable electricity?
Absolutely. It supports generator input and off-grid operation, making it ideal for weak-grid regions.
